Travis Kelce has expressed his desire to stay with the Kansas City Chiefs, but he has yet to make a decision about his retirement. This uncertainty follows the Chiefs’ loss to the Philadelphia Eagles in the 2025 Super Bowl.
If Kelce decides to retire, he could have a promising future as an actor. He has already appeared in television shows like Are You Smarter Than a Celebrity? on Amazon Prime and Grotesquerie. His performances have even earned him praise from actor Adam Sandler.
Sandler is set to release the sequel to his Netflix hit Happy Gilmore 2 in July 2025. Travis Kelce has been cast in the movie, though his exact role remains unclear. However, the first trailer reveals the Chiefs’ star playing a waiter in one of the scenes.

During the Saturday Night Live 50th Anniversary Special in New York, Sandler spoke to the media about his upcoming film. He also shared his thoughts on Travis Kelce’s acting abilities, saying, “Very funny… Funny as hell… No joke, incredible.”
Considering Sandler’s status as one of Hollywood’s most popular comedians, his praise for Kelce carries significant weight.
